500.com Limited Announces Unaudited Financial Results for the Second Quarter of 2019

 

SHENZHEN, China, August 6, 2019—500.com Limited (NYSE: WBAI) (“500.com” or the “Company”), a leading online sports lottery service provider in China, today reported its unaudited financial results for the second quarter ended June 30, 2019.

 

Physical Sales Channels of Sports Lottery Tickets

 

In March 2018, the Company entered into a framework agreement with the China Sports Lottery Administration Center (“CSLA”), pursuant to which the Company will cooperate with CSLA to develop physical channels to sell sports lottery tickets.

 

As of the reporting date, the Company had entered into framework agreements with Tianjin, Hunan and several other provincial (including regional and municipal) sports lottery centers and started operations in Tianjin, Hunan, Hubei, Guangxi and several other provinces and cities in China. The Company is committed to assisting sports lottery sales organizations throughout the country to improve the distribution of physical sales channel outlets in order to facilitate sports lottery ticket purchases and optimize the experience of lottery purchasers.

 

Suspension of Online Sports Lottery Sales in China

 

All provincial sports lottery administration centers to which the Company provided sports lottery sales services have suspended accepting online purchase orders for lottery products in response to the Notice related to Self-Inspection and Self-Remedy of Unauthorized Online Lottery Sales (the “Self-Inspection Notice”), which was jointly promulgated by the Ministry of Finance, the Ministry of Civil Affairs and the General Administration of Sports of the People’s Republic of China on January 15, 2015. In response to the Self-Inspection Notice, on April 4, 2015, the Company decided to voluntarily suspend all online lottery sales services. As a result of the provincial sport lottery administration centers’ decision to suspend accepting online lottery orders and the Company’s voluntary suspension of all online sports lottery sales services in China, the Company has not generated any revenue from these services since April 2015.

Second Quarter 2019 Financial Results

 

Net Revenues

 

Net revenues were RMB11.1 million (US$1.6 million) for the second quarter of 2019, representing a decrease of RMB19.3 million or 63.5% from RMB30.4 million for the second quarter of 2018 and a decrease of RMB3.2 million or 22.4% from RMB14.3 million for the first quarter of 2019. Net revenues during the second quarter of 2019 consisted primarily of RMB11.0 million (EUR1.4 million) in revenue contribution from the Company’s online lottery betting and online casino in Europe through TMG, which accounted for 99.1% of total net revenues. The year-over-year decrease was mainly attributable to a decrease of RMB16.1 million resulting from the website migration in connection with the conversion of TMG’s Swedish license, which migration required users to re-register, and a decrease of RMB3.1 million caused by the ceased operation of sports information services in China in March 2019. The sequential decrease was mainly attributable to a decrease of RMB3.3 million caused by the ceased operation of sports information services in China in March 2019.

 

Operating Expenses

 

Operating expenses were RMB87.8 million (US$12.8 million) for the second quarter of 2019, representing a decrease of RMB23.0 million or 20.8% from RMB110.8 million for the second quarter of 2018, and a decrease of RMB23.4 million or 21.0% from RMB111.2 million for the first quarter of 2019. The year-over-year decrease was mainly due to a decrease of RMB14.5 million in marketing and promotional expenses relating to a change in TMG’s marketing strategy, a decrease of RMB2.8 million in lottery insurance costs for TMG associated with its reduced online lottery operations, a decrease of RMB2.5 million in consulting expenses, a decrease of RMB2.4 million in expenses for employees, a decrease of RMB0.8 million in depreciation and amortization associated with leasehold improvements, a decrease of RMB0.8 million in account handling expenses and a decrease of RMB0.4 million in platform service costs for TMG associated with its reduction in online lottery and online casino operations, which were partially offset by an increase of RMB1.1 million in regulatory and compliance fees related to TMG’s Swedish license, and an increase of RMB0.9 million in share-based compensation expenses associated with share options granted to the Company’s employees. The sequential decrease was mainly due to a decrease of RMB8.5 million in share-based compensation expenses associated with share options granted to the Company’s employees, a decrease of RMB8.5 million in depreciation and amortization associated with leasehold improvements, a decrease of RMB4.4 million in marketing and promotional expenses mainly relating to a change in TMG’s marketing strategy, a decrease of RMB0.9 million in expenses for employees and a decrease of RMB0.5 million in account handling expenses.

 

Cost of services was RMB16.5 million (US$2.4 million) for the second quarter of 2019, representing a decrease of RMB2.9 million or 14.9% from RMB19.4 million for the second quarter of 2018, and a slight decrease of RMB0.5 million or 2.9% from RMB17.0 million for the first quarter of 2019. The year-over-year decrease was mainly attributable to a decrease of RMB2.8 million in lottery insurance costs, a decrease of RMB0.8 million in account handling expenses and a decrease of RMB0.4 in platform service costs. All of the above decreases were associated with TMG’s reduced online lottery and online casino operations, which were partially offset by an increase of RMB1.1 million in regulatory and compliance fees related to TMG’s Swedish license.

Sales and marketing expenses were RMB9.6 million (US$1.4 million) for the second quarter of 2019, representing a decrease of RMB11.9 million or 55.3% from RMB21.5 million for the second quarter of 2018, and a decrease of RMB5.2 million or 35.1% from RMB14.8 million for the first quarter of 2019. The year-over-year decrease was mainly attributable to a decrease of RMB14.5 million in marketing and promotional expenses relating to a change in TMG’s marketing strategy, which was partially offset by an increase of RMB1.6 million in expenses for employees in connection with the operation of physical sales channels of sports lottery tickets started in the third quarter of 2018, an increase of RMB0.3 million in depreciation associated with leasehold improvements for the Company’s provincial offices for physical sales channels of sports lottery tickets and an increase of RMB0.3 million in rental expenses associated with the Company’s provincial offices for physical sales channels of sports lottery tickets. The sequential decrease was mainly attributable to a decrease of RMB4.4 million in marketing and promotional expenses mainly relating to a change in TMG’s marketing strategy and a decrease of RMB0.9 million in share-based compensation expenses associated with share options granted to the Company’s employees.

 

General and administrative expenses were RMB50.0 million (US$7.3 million) for the second quarter of 2019, representing a decrease of RMB6.1 million or 10.9% from RMB56.1 million for the second quarter of 2018, and a decrease of RMB15.7 million or 23.9% from RMB65.7 million for the first quarter of 2019. The year-over-year decrease was mainly due to a decrease of RMB2.9 million in expenses for employees, a decrease of RMB2.1 million in consulting expenses and a decrease of RMB1.1 million in depreciation and amortization associated with leasehold improvements. The sequential decrease was mainly due to a decrease of RMB8.5 million in depreciation and amortization associated with leasehold improvements, a decrease of RMB6.1 million in share-based compensation expenses associated with share options granted to the Company’s employees, and a decrease of RMB1.0 million in expenses for employees.

 

Service development expenses were RMB11.8 million (US$1.7 million) for the second quarter of 2019, representing a decrease of RMB1.9 million or 13.9% from RMB13.7 million for the second quarter of 2018, and a decrease of RMB2.0 million or 14.5% from RMB13.8 million for the first quarter of 2019. The year-over-year decrease was mainly due to a decrease of RMB1.1 million in expenses for employees, a decrease of RMB0.3 million in consulting expenses, and a decrease of RMB0.2 million in share-based compensation expenses associated with share options granted to the Company’s employees. The sequential decrease was mainly due to a decrease of RMB1.6 million in share-based compensation expenses associated with share options granted to the Company’s employees and a decrease of RMB0.2 million in expenses for employees.

 

Impairment of Goodwill

 

Impairment of goodwill was RMB57.2 million (US$8.3 million) for the second quarter of 2019. There was no such impairment for the first quarter of 2019 and the second quarter of 2018. The impairment of goodwill was related to the Company’s acquisition of TMG.

 

Operating Loss

 

Operating loss was RMB138.3 million (US$20.1 million) for the second quarter of 2019, including the impairment of goodwill of RMB57.2 million (US$8.3 million), compared with operating loss of RMB72.0 million for the second quarter of 2018, and operating loss of RMB97.3 million for the first quarter of 2019.

 

Non-GAAP operating loss was RMB118.1 million (US$17.2 million) for the second quarter of 2019, compared with non-GAAP operating loss of RMB52.7 million for the second quarter of 2018, and non-GAAP operating loss of RMB68.6 million for the first quarter of 2019.

Net Loss Attributable to 500.com

 

Net loss attributable to 500.com was RMB137.8 million (US$20.1 million) for the second quarter of 2019, compared with net loss attributable to 500.com of RMB48.6 million for the second quarter of 2018, and net loss attributable to 500.com of RMB93.2 million for the first quarter of 2019. The year-over-year increase was mainly due to an impairment provision of RMB57.2 million for goodwill during the second quarter of 2019 and a reversal of uncertain tax liabilities of RMB20.7 million during the second quarter of 2018. The sequential increase was mainly due to an impairment provision of RMB57.2 million for goodwill during the second quarter of 2019.

Business Outlook

 

The Company does not expect to issue any earnings forecast until it receives clear instructions as to the resumption date of online sports lottery sales from the Ministry of Finance.

 

Currency Convenience Translation

 

This announcement contains translations of certain Renminbi amounts into U.S. dollars at specified rates solely for the convenience of readers. Unless otherwise noted, all translations from Renminbi to U.S. dollars were made at the exchange rate of RMB6.8650 to US$1.00, as set forth in the H.10 statistical release of the Federal Reserve Board on June 28, 2019, and all translations from Renminbi to EUR were made at the exchange rate of RMB7.6488 to EUR1.00, which was the average of the month-end exchange rates as set forth in the statistical release of State Administration of Foreign Exchange at the end of each month in 2019.

 

About 500.com Limited

 

500.com Limited (NYSE: WBAI) is a leading online sports lottery service provider in China. The Company offers a comprehensive and integrated suite of online lottery services, information, user tools and virtual community venues to its users. 500.com was among the first companies to provide online lottery services in China, and is one of two entities that have been approved by the Ministry of Finance to provide online lottery sales services on behalf of the China Sports Lottery Administration Center, which is the government authority that is in charge of the issuance and sale of sports lottery products in China.
